Pronunciation and Spelling

Avellina is a name that is both beautiful and easy to pronounce, with its gentle rhythm and flowing syllables. The name is typically pronounced "ah-veh-lee-nah," with a slight emphasis on the second syllable. While the spelling is relatively straightforward, there are some common variations that may arise. For instance, some individuals may opt for the more common "Avelina," or choose to embrace the Italian spelling, "Avellana," which adds a touch of Mediterranean flair.

Nickname Choices

Avellina offers a range of potential nicknames, each with its own charm and personality. Common options include "Avi," "Lina," "Ella," and "Vella," each offering a different flavor. These nicknames can be used affectionately by family and friends, adding another layer of intimacy and warmth to the name.

Variation and Similar Names

Avellina has several variations, including "Avelina," "Avellana," and "Avelin," each offering a slightly different feel. Other names with similar sounds and rhythms include "Allina," "Orlantha," and "Venessia," providing a range of options for those who appreciate the name's unique charm.
